The date has been set for January’s N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week, a hugely popular event in Newcastle’s event calendar and a hotly anticipated date for all Northern foodies. From 16th– 22nd January, NE1 will be hosting the 13th N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week and will celebrate a major milestone in the event’s six-year history as it welcomes over 100 restaurants to take part.

100 Milestone Mark Reached by

The rising number of participants mirrors the growth of the city’s restaurant scene, 24 new restaurants are to open in the new intu Eldon Square Grey’s Quarter alone and Newcastle currently offers more restaurants per square foot than any other Northern city.

Among these new sign ups are brands new to the city that were quick to register to take part in what will be their first N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week, including Chaophraya and the newly launched Dobson and Parnell: the latest venture from award winning restaurateur, Andy Hook. Newcastle diners and food lovers will be given the opportunity to try out these new venues for only £10 or £15 per head.

The event continues to grow in popularity and status year on year. At the last count, over 350,000 diners had taken part in N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week since its launch in January 2011 with over 40,000 dining during last August’s Restaurant Week alone.

The idea for N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week came from New York where twice a year diners get the chance to eat out at some of the city’s top restaurants for a fraction of the normal price. The formula translates well to Newcastle, a city with a vibrant restaurant scene whose vibrancy only increases each January and August, when N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week is held. Venues devise show-stopping menus to attract new diners, many of whom are keen to try out venues for the first time, encouraged by the NE1 Newcastle Restaurant Week offer.

Newcastle is also home to a truly cosmopolitan mix of restaurants and menus ensuring all tastes are catered for. Diners can eat out ‘around the world’ in Newcastle from Italian, Spanish Tapas to Chinese, Brazilian, German and Indian.
